Hallo
DP,
ich möchte in einem Dialog, der in einer
COM DLL liegt, gerne das Compile/Build Datum anzeigen. Für EXE Datein verwende ich den Code aus der
DP. (Noch mal Danke dafür!) Bei einer
DLL funktioniert das damit aber leider nicht.
Daher ein bis zwei Fragen: Steht das Build Datum überhaupt in einer
COM DLL drin? Und falls ja, wie kann man es auslesen?
Ich verwende derzeit in Delphi 2006 Pro einen anderen Ansatz: Das
Freeware-Tool CTime habe ich auf die "neue" OpenToolsAPI umgeschrieben (lief eigentlich nur bis D7). CTime erstellt bei jedem Compileraufruf eine INC-Datei, die zwei Konstanten für Datum und Zeit enthält, die dann angezeigt werden kann.
Der Ansatz, direkt aus der
DLL das BuildDate auszulesen, gefällt mir dennoch irgendwie besser, da ich dann nicht auf die
IDE-Erweiterung angewiesen wäre. Oder kann mir vielleicht jemand einen anderen Tipp geben (z.B. Buildereignisse o.ä.)?
Schon mal vielen Dank!
Viele Grüße
Timo
PS: Tipps zum Umschreiben des CompileTime Tools auf die "neue" OTA habe ich bei
CodeGear und
Mustang Peak gefunden.